**Quarterly Planning Note — Warranty Overrun**

Branch managers: warranty claims on the Ferrow 9 pump ran 40% over forecast this quarter. Root cause is a seal defect in the spring production batch. Tighten inspection at intake, log every claim in full, and escalate repeat failures to regional. A revised reserve figure follows next month. The confidential plan affecting all branches appears directly below.

board note of kagep-yahig: Only 9 of the 120 pilot accounts renewed Quenix, so a churn review is set for April 1.

CI note for the Harrowfield telemetry gateway: the nightly pipeline failed intermittently at the firmware-packaging stage, traced to a stale cross-compile cache on runner pool B. We purged the cache, pinned the toolchain image, and reran three consecutive green builds. No telemetry schema changes were involved. For release sign-off, please verify against the build identifier below.

build token for kagaf-hahof: htk14_9d3d4d26d7d8de

Internal Memo — Launch of the Halewick Premium Tier

To all branch managers: effective next quarter, Halewick introduces a premium subscription tier with expanded support hours and priority provisioning. Pricing materials arrive next week; do not quote figures until then. Staff training sessions will be scheduled per branch. Migration incentives apply to existing annual subscribers only. The confidential commercial reasoning is set out immediately below.

board note of bawep-tajef: Queniusek Systems plans to raise the Quenvan list price by 53.1 percent in March. The pricing group signed off on a budget of $176.4 million for Project Drueth. The renewal with Casionix Partners closes at $142.5 million a year, 8.3 percent below the last contract. Project Fraax slips by six weeks because of the tooling delay.

Changelog 4.2.0 — Pickwright Optimizer (Fernhollow Logistics). Default behavior has changed for plugin authors: the optimizer now batches aisles by zone weight rather than raw distance, and the congestion penalty is enabled out of the box. Plugins relying on the old distance-first ordering must opt out explicitly via the hooks API. Cold-start heuristics were also retuned, so benchmark your plugins against 4.2 before shipping. The new default configuration shipped with this release is listed below.

config for kafof-bawef:
holath:
  log_level: debug
  metrics_host: metrics.holath.qorvelsys.internal
  pin: 2191
  pool_size: 32